Cloud server, referred to as cloud host for short, is a virtual server built based on cloud computing technology. By running virtualization software on a physical server, computing resources such as CPU, memory, etc. are divided to form multiple virtual machines, and each virtual machine is a cloud server. The core advantages of cloud servers are their elastic scalability, high cost-effectiveness, fast access speed, high stability and reliability. Compared with traditional physical servers, cloud servers can be deployed and managed quickly, helping enterprises to flexibly respond to business changes and effectively reduce IT costs. Among them, elastic scaling is one of the important features of cloud servers. It allows users to increase or decrease resources at any time as needed, greatly improving resource utilization efficiency and enterprise operational flexibility.

The technical principles of cloud servers are mainly based on virtualization and cloud computing technology.
Virtualization technology is the technical basis for cloud server implementation. It abstracts and divides the computing resources in the physical server into multiple independent virtual units through software. Each virtual unit can be used as an independent server to run different operating systems. and applications. This method greatly improves the utilization of physical resources and makes resource allocation more flexible and efficient.
Cloud computing platform is the infrastructure that provides cloud server services. It integrates a large number of physical servers and integrates these distributed resources through the network to build a powerful resource pool that can be shared by many users. Users can apply for, use, and manage their own cloud servers on this platform through the Internet, and can adjust the amount of resources used at any time as needed.

When choosing a cloud server, enterprises should consider the following factors:
Assess the requirements for server CPU, memory, storage and bandwidth based on the nature and scale of the business. Choose a cloud server configuration that meets your current needs and has a certain amount of reserved space.
Security is one of the factors that cannot be ignored when choosing a cloud server. Understand the security measures of cloud service providers, including data encryption, network protection, authentication, etc., to ensure the security of data and applications.
Evaluate the overall cost of the cloud server, including initial investment, usage costs, and possible expansion costs. Make the most reasonable choice based on the company's financial situation and cost control requirements.
Choose a cloud service provider with a good market reputation and stable operation history, understand its customer service quality, and ensure that you can obtain necessary technical support and service guarantee during use.
